Sprawdzanie ortografii w wybranym języku w PSI
Od jakiegoś czasu komunikatory mają bardzo przydatną opcję – potrafią sprawdzać pisownię i wskazywać słowa, które według słownika napisane są niepoprawnie.
PSI – mój komunikator “z wyboru” również posiada tę jakże przydatną opcję. Niestety, twórcy nie przewidzieli, że możemy rozmawiać z osobami z różnych stron świata, pisać w różnych językach – komunikator pobiera systemowe ustawienie dotyczące języka i tylko odpowiadający mu słownik jest wykorzystany do sprawdzania ortografii.
Na szczęście problem został zauważony i powstał patch dodający możliwość wyboru języka. Pobieramy plik podlinkowany na końcu postu, rozpakowujemy do katalogu w którym znajdują się też rozpakowane źródła PSI, zakładamy łatkę i po kompilacji można się cieszyć nowymi możliwościami PSI.
A oto pełen przepis na nową funkcjonalność:
$ wget http://downloads.sourceforge.net/psi/psi-0.11.tar.gz
$ tar xzf psi-0.11.tar.gz
$ wget http://www.ndl.kiev.ua/downloads/psi-0.11_aspell_multi_langs.patch.gz
$ gunzip psi-0.11_aspell_multi_langs.patch.gz
$ patch -p0 < psi-0.11_aspell_multi_langs.patch
$ cd psi-0.11
$ configure
$ make
# make install